The global tablet market is projected to reach $202.4 billion by 2033, growing from $84.6 billion in 2024. Apple and Samsung dominate with 31.7% and 21.7% market share respectively, while budget models like the Amazon Fire HD 10 lead consumer sales. This analysis examines the top-selling tablets across price segments, backed by 2025 market data and consumer trends.

Top-Selling Tablets by Market Segment

Consumer and commercial markets show distinct purchasing patterns, with budget models dominating retail sales while premium devices lead in business procurement.

Product Price Range Market Share (2025) Primary Use Case Key Differentiator
Amazon Fire HD 10 (2024) $99-$129 18.2% Entertainment/Education Best value for media consumption
Apple iPad (10th Gen) $329-$429 15.6% General Productivity iOS ecosystem integration
Samsung Galaxy Tab A9+ $159-$199 12.4% Education/Budget Business DeX desktop experience
Apple iPad Pro (2024) $799-$1,099 9.8% Professional Workflows M4 chip performance
Samsung Galaxy Tab S10 $699-$999 8.5% Business/Productivity S Pen integration
Table data sources: 3, 2

Analysis of the tablet market reveals clear segmentation: budget models under $200 capture 42% of total unit sales but only 28% of revenue, while premium tablets ($600+) represent 24% of units but 41% of revenue. This indicates strong market polarization between value-conscious consumers and professionals willing to pay for performance.

Consumer Market Leaders

The Amazon Fire HD 10 continues to dominate the sub-$150 segment with its optimized Fire OS for media consumption. In Q2 2025, it captured 37% of all tablets sold under $200 on Amazon, outperforming competitors through strategic bundling with Prime Video and Kindle services 2.

Apple's iPad maintains strong presence across multiple price points, with the standard iPad (10th generation) serving as the entry point to the iOS ecosystem. Its 15.6% market share represents remarkable resilience against lower-priced alternatives, attributed to software longevity and resale value 3.

Commercial/B2B Market Analysis

Business procurement shows different patterns, with Apple and Samsung commanding 53.4% combined market share in enterprise deployments. Key factors driving commercial adoption include:

  • Security and Management: Apple's centralized device management and Samsung's Knox platform provide enterprise-grade security essential for business deployments 1
  • Durability Requirements: Commercial tablets show 63% higher demand for ruggedized models compared to consumer segments
  • Software Integration: Seamless integration with existing productivity suites drives 78% of enterprise purchasing decisions

Regional Market Variations

Market leadership varies significantly by region, with important implications for global sourcing strategies:

Region Market Leader Market Share Price Sensitivity Index Primary Use Case
North America Apple iPad 41.2% Medium Professional use
Europe Samsung Galaxy Tab 38.7% High Education
Asia-Pacific Amazon Fire HD 32.5% Very High Entertainment
Latin America Lenovo Tab Series 28.9% Extreme Basic computing
Middle East/Africa Amazon Fire HD 44.3% Extreme Primary computing device
Table data sources: 3, 1

Regional analysis shows Amazon Fire HD dominates value-sensitive markets, capturing 44.3% share in Middle East/Africa where it serves as the primary computing device for many households. Meanwhile, Apple maintains dominance in North America (41.2% share) where professional use cases drive premium purchases. Price sensitivity directly correlates with regional GDP, explaining the strong performance of budget models in emerging economies.

Key Factors Driving Tablet Sales in 2025

Several interconnected factors explain current market dynamics:

  1. Hybrid Work Evolution: 68% of organizations now deploy tablets as secondary devices for meetings and collaborative work, up from 42% in 2022 1
  2. Education Technology Investment: Global edtech spending reached $420 billion in 2025, with tablets comprising 31% of hardware investments 2
  3. Entertainment Consolidation: Streaming services increasingly optimize for tablet interfaces, with 73% of users preferring tablets over smartphones for video consumption
  4. Longer Product Cycles: Average tablet replacement cycles extended to 3.2 years in 2025, up from 2.4 years in 2021, indicating improved device longevity

Future Market Outlook

The tablet market will continue evolving with several key trends:

  • Foldable Technology: Expected to capture 12% market share by 2027, creating new premium categories
  • AI Integration: On-device AI processing will become standard, enhancing productivity features
  • Education Focus: 65% of future growth will come from education technology deployments in developing markets

As the market matures, differentiation will increasingly come from software ecosystems and specialized use cases rather than hardware specifications alone. The most successful tablets will be those that solve specific user problems rather than attempting to be general-purpose devices.
